Cape Town Durban Ermelo Johannesburg Ballito Pretoria Plettenberg Bay Stellenbosch Southbroom Margate

Accommodation in Johannesburg, Spoken languages: Zulu; Amenities: Private pool; Pool: Towels

Africa South Africa Gauteng Johannesburg
Order by on page